# Python中使用json.get()获取默认值Python中,我们经常会使用json模块来处理JSON数据。当我们需要从JSON数据中获取某个字段的时,有时候这个字段可能不存在,这时候我们可以使用`get()`方法来获取默认值。 `get()`方法允许我们指定一个默认值,在目标字段不存在时返回这个默认值。这在处理复杂的JSON数据结构时非常有用,可以避免出现KeyError异常。
原创 2024-03-20 07:15:08
436阅读
1.条件语句 if <条件判断1>: <执行1> elif <条件判断2>: <执行2> elif <条件判断3>: <执行3> else: <执行4>2.input语句input()返回的数据类型是str,str不能直接和整数比较,必须先把str转换成整数。Python
# 如何实现“npm config get python默认值” ## 流程图 ```mermaid flowchart TD start[开始] step1[安装npm] step2[配置python默认值] end[结束] start --> step1 step1 --> step2 step2 --> end ``` ## 步
原创 2024-03-11 05:12:15
275阅读
# Python中的`None`类型与默认值Python编程中,`None` 是一个特殊的类型,它通常用于表示“无”或“缺失”。当我们需要定义一个函数时,一些参数可能会有默认值,而这些默认值通常会被设置为 `None`。如果用户没有传入相应的参数,我们便可以使用默认值。在这篇文章中,我们将讨论如何处理 `None` 并设置默认值,同时给出相应的代码示例。 ## 什么是`None`?
原创 2024-10-08 06:18:51
37阅读
# Java对象获取默认值的实现 ## 简介 在Java开发中,我们经常需要获取对象的默认值。这对于刚入行的开发者来说可能是一个挑战,但实际上它并不复杂。在本文中,我将向你展示一个简单的步骤来实现"Java对象获取默认值"。我会通过表格和代码示例来帮助你理解每个步骤的具体操作。 ## 步骤 下面是实现"Java对象获取默认值"的步骤: | 步骤 | 描述 | | --- | --- |
原创 2024-01-11 11:27:35
14阅读
介绍Project Lombok is a java library that automatically plugs into your editor and build tools, spicing up your java.Never write another getter or equals method again, with one annotation your class has
1.在redis客户端获取redis 配置文件的某个配置信息(需要先打开redis客户端)  config get 配置项   ,如果要列出所有的配置项(*) 2.在redis 客户端查看redis 所使用的密码   config get requirepass3.如何修改redis配置项呢? 可以通过修改 redis.conf 文件或使
转载 2024-05-28 19:47:34
18阅读
你写了一个Python 3程序,还想要它适用于其他语言。你能复制全部代码库,然后刻意地检查每个.py文件,替换掉所有找到的文本字符串。但这意味着你有两份你代码的独立副本,每当你要做出个改动或修复个bug,你的工作量会加倍。而且如果你想要程序还适用于其他语言,就更糟了。幸运的是,Python给了一个解决办法,就是用gettext模块。一个Hack解法你应该把你自己的解决办法统一改变。例如,你可以把你
在上一章使uboot支持网卡传输文件后,但是每次启机时,环境变量都要变为默认值,需要重新设置ip,MAC地址才行,由于没有配置mtdparts命令,启动内核也不成功所以本章主要学习:1)修改环境变量默认值2)裁剪uboot  3)分区,设置mtdparts命令1.修改之前,先来理解下uboot的环境参数首先,uboot会去校验(CRC)存放环境变量的一段空间 ,若CRC有效则使用该空间里
转载 2024-01-10 16:26:49
192阅读
# Java中get方法返回默认值的实现方法 ## 1. 流程概述 为了实现“Java get方法返回默认值”,我们可以按照以下步骤进行操作: 1. 创建一个Java类,并定义需要的属性和方法。 2. 在get方法中判断属性是否为null,如果为null则返回默认值,否则返回属性的。 3. 在调用get方法时,可以通过设置默认值的方式来获取返回。 下面将详细介绍每一步的具体操作。 #
原创 2023-12-13 09:35:42
240阅读
python默认参数python可以使用变量作为默认参数,但是该变量必须在函数定义之前就已经声明。比如i = 1 def func( _i = i ): print(_i) func() #1同时,对于python默认参数在函数定义的时候就已经计算好了。def func( list=[] ): list.append('a') print(list) func() #['a
转载 2023-06-16 14:34:43
399阅读
注:本博客实例均是使用的Python编译器--pycharm默认参数问题引入日常中,我们经常经常计算x^2,所以,完全可以把power()第二个参数n的默认值设定为2:def power(x, n=2): s = 1 while n > 0: n = n - 1 s = s * x return s这样,当调用power(6)时,相当于
转载 2024-04-15 16:00:30
89阅读
在开发Spring Boot应用时,处理GET请求时常常需要对请求参数进行封装,并为某些参数设置默认值。本文将详细记录解决“Spring Boot GET封装默认值”问题的方法,涵盖环境准备、集成步骤、配置详解、实战应用、性能优化和生态扩展等内容。 ### 环境准备 首先,我们需要为开发环境准备依赖项。确保安装了以下工具和框架: - Java 11及以上版本 - Spring Boot 2.
原创 6月前
35阅读
## Java中的get和set方法默认值 在Java编程中,我们经常会使用类的属性来存储和操作数据。为了访问和修改这些属性,通常会使用get和set方法。在这篇文章中,我们将探讨Java中get和set方法的默认值以及如何设置和获取它们。 ### 什么是get和set方法? 在面向对象的编程中,get和set方法是用于访问和修改类的属性的一种约定。get方法用于获取属性的,而set方法用
原创 2023-10-21 06:32:59
493阅读
顾名思义,Python中的默认参数就是你什么都不用输出,程序自动给你补上一个默认值,我们来看一下例子。
转载 2023-05-26 23:53:54
349阅读
①hashCode: 散列码(hashcode)是由对象导出的一个整型。散列码是没有规律的。如果x和y是两个不同的对象,x.hashcode()和y.hashcode()基本上不会相同。 下面给出通过调用String类的hashcode方法得到的散列码:int hash = 0; for(int i = 0;i < length(); i++) hash = 31 * hash
转载 2023-12-18 16:10:26
38阅读
我有一个将列表作为参数的python函数。如果我将参数的默认值设置为如下空列表:def func(items=[]):print items皮林特会告诉我"危险的默认值[]作为参数"。所以我想知道这里的最佳实践是什么?这是每一个Python新手都会碰上一两次的东西,皮林特阻止你写一个可怕的虫子真是太酷了!使用None作为默认值:def func(items=None):if items is No
01 Python标准输入输出数据的输入input()函数用于输入数据,无论用户输入什么内容,该函数都返回字符串类型。格式:input(prompt=None,/)其中prompt表示提示信息,默认为空,如果不空,则显示提示信息。然后等待用户输入,输入完毕后按回车键,并将用户输入作为一个字符串返回,并自动忽略换行符。n可以通过类型转换函数int()、float()等将字符串转换成数值。有些场合还可
我们知道,在调用函数时,如果不指定某个参数,解释器会抛出异常。为了解决这个问题,Python 允许为参数设置默认值,即在定义函数时,直接给形式参数指定一个默认值,这样的话,即便调用函数时没有给拥有默认值的形参传递参数,该参数可以直接使用定义函数时设置的默认值。 定义带有默认值参数的函数,其语法格式如下:def 函数名(...,形参名=默认值): 代码块注意,在使用此格式定义函数时
转载 2023-06-29 13:45:40
112阅读
# Python中的默认值设置 ## 一、整体流程 在Python中,我们可以通过设置默认值来为函数的参数提供默认数值或者对象。这在实际开发中非常有用,可以减少重复代码的编写,提高代码的可维护性和复用性。下面我将为你介绍如何在Python中设置默认值。 ### 1. 甘特图 ```mermaid gantt title 设置Python默认值流程 section 理解需求
原创 2024-03-30 05:22:45
20阅读
  • 1
  • 2
  • 3
  • 4
  • 5